Job description

Senior Embedded Systems Architect – Firmware

Grace Technologies is accelerating the industrial world’s transition to zero downtime and zero harm. We design intelligent electrical safety and predictive maintenance solutions trusted by global data centers, utilities, and industrial facilities making maintenance safer, smarter and more efficient.

Location: Davenport, IA

Role Summary

Under the direction of the CTO, the Senior Embedded Systems Architect – Firmware is responsible for architecting, developing, and delivering embedded firmware solutions from concept through production. This role provides senior technical leadership across the embedded systems stack and plays a key role in shaping both current products and future technology roadmaps.

Key Responsibilities
  • Architect system-level firmware and make technical decisions guiding current products and future roadmap initiatives
  • Translate business and product requirements into scalable firmware architectures aligned with company strategy
  • Serve as a senior technical resource across embedded systems, including firmware, hardware design, schematics, layouts, and BOMs
  • Design, develop, test, and maintain reliable and reusable embedded firmware solutions
  • Partner with Product and Project Management to define technical scope, estimate timelines, and execute firmware projects end-to-end
  • Lead development and execution of firmware test plans and test cases to ensure hardware-software compatibility and optimized performance
  • Support testing and debugging efforts, including in-depth troubleshooting when required
  • Conduct firmware code reviews and mentor engineering team members on best practices, code quality, and documentation standards
  • Drive continuous improvement by evaluating and implementing new tools, technologies, and methodologies
  • Stay current on industry trends and collaborate with the CTO to apply emerging technologies to embedded products
  • Communicate complex technical concepts clearly to both technical and non-technical stakeholders
Required Education & Experience
  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Software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or equivalent
  • 10+ years of experience in embedded systems engineering, including microprocessor-based system design and programming; full software and hardware development lifecycle (requirements, design, coding, testing, CI)
  • 3+ years of project management experience, including scope definition, requirements documentation, budgeting, scheduling, resource planning, and risk assessment
Required Technical Skills
  • Strong embedded C programming experience in fixed- and floating-point systems
  • Experience supporting multiple MPU platforms for new hardware designs
  • Deep understanding of embedded system design and common peripherals (SPI, I2C, UART, DMA, ADC, DAC)
  • Proficiency with lab-based debugging tools (oscilloscope, logic analyzer, multimeter, power supply, frequency generator)
  • Working knowledge of RF communication systems and associated protocols
  • Proficiency with Git or similar code versioning tools
  • Working knowledge of SQL databases
  • Familiarity with common data formats (XML, JSON)
  • Working knowledge of Agile and Waterfall development methodologies
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
Language, Reasoning & Collaboration Skills
  • Ability to read and interpret technical specifications, schematics, engineering change notices, and professional journals
  • Ability to prepare technical documentation, reports, and training or educational materials
  • Ability to communicate effectively with vendors, customers, and cross-functional teams
  • Strong problem-solving skills in environments with limited standardization and evolving requirements
  • Demonstrated ability to lead teams through the embedded systems development lifecycle
